Abstract
Sub-picosecond polarization control is a fundamental functionality for several applications, from information encoding to probing of chemical systems such as chiral molecules. We present an all-optically reconfigurable AlGaAs metasurface, showing giant dichroism modulation upon investigation via ultrafast pump-probe spectroscopy. By combining modelling of carriers excitation and relaxation processes with full-wave electromagnetic simulations, we can attribute the relevant transient features to pump-induced band-filling effect, opening a gain region in the spectral range of a sharp resonance of the structure.
